Who Is Willie Mays?
Before exploring the phrase's significance, it’s essential to understand who Willie Mays is. Born on May 6, 1931, in Westfield, Alabama, Willie Mays is widely regarded as one of the greatest baseball players of all time. His career spanned over two decades, primarily with the New York/San Francisco Giants and later the New York Mets.
Known for his exceptional athleticism, defensive prowess, and hitting ability, Mays earned numerous accolades, including:
- 24-time All-Star
- Two-time National League MVP
- 12 Gold Glove Awards
- Induction into the Baseball Hall of Fame in 1979
